Franck Vidal is a senior lecturer in computer science at Bangor University. His research focuses on image analysis and computer vision, mathematical optimisation, and high-performance computing. He has held research positions in France, Wales and the United States of America and developed a keen interest in large multi-disciplinary research projects. He worked at the Laboratory of Non-destructive Testing using Ionizing Radiations of INSA-Lyon on investigating artefact sources in synchrotron microtomography. In Bangor, Wales, he developed virtual reality training tools for interventional radiology. He worked on a novel algorithm based for positron emission tomography (PET) at the French Atomic Energy Commission (CEA) and the French national research institute in computer science and automation (Inria). He developed Compton scattering computations on GPU at the Department of Radiation Oncology of the University of California, San Diego (UCSD). He has been awarded grants from the European Commission, European Synchrotron Radiation Facilities (ESRF), NVIDIA, Santander, Fisheries Society of the British Isles, and the Royal Academy of Engineering. Since 2017, he is the secretary of EGUK, the UK Chapter of the Eurographics. He was Programme co-chair of EGUK’s Computer Graphics and Visual Computing conference in 2017 and 2018, guest editor of special editions of MDPI Computers (2018 and 2019). Since 2019, he is associate Editor of Array, journal published by Elsevier.
